Heim >Web-Frontend >js-Tutorial >Mit Javascript kann sich DEDECMS von handschriftlichen Tag_Javascript-Fähigkeiten verabschieden

Mit Javascript kann sich DEDECMS von handschriftlichen Tag_Javascript-Fähigkeiten verabschieden

WB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WB
WB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OYWBOriginal
2016-05-16 16:38:111300Durchsuche

1. Öffnen Sie die Datei dedetempletsalbum_add.htm und fügen Sie die js-Methode im js-Skriptbereich im oberen Kopf hinzu.

function setag(){
 var tagg=window.showModalDialog("tags_main.php","tag","dialogWidth=800px;dialogHeight=600px"); 
  if(typeof(tagg) != 'undefined') document.form1.tags.value=tagg; 
      }


2. Fügen Sie in dem im Tag-Tag eingegebenen td

hinzu

Ein Knopf.

3. Ändern Sie die Datei dedetempletstags_main.php und fügen Sie den folgenden js-Code im oberen Kopfbereich hinzu.

//选择关键字
var tag="";
function selectTag(str)
{
tag=tag+","+str;
if (tag.substr(0,1)==',') tag=tag.substr(1);
 $("#selecttag").val(tag); 
}

function selectTagOK()
{
window.returnValue= $("#selecttag").val(); 
window.close(); 
}

4. Fügen Sie den folgenden HTML-Code an einer beliebigen Stelle im Textkörper hinzu, PS: an der Stelle, an der Sie ihn anzeigen möchten

<div style="padding-left:20px;border:1px">所选TAG: <input type='text' id='selecttag' name='selecttag' size='80'/><input type="button" onClick="selectTagOK()" value="确定选择"/> </div>
5. Suchen Sie

in der Tag-Liste

<a href="../tags.php&#63;/<&#63;php echo urlencode($fields['tag']); &#63;>/" target="_blank">{dede:field.tag /}</a>
Ändern Sie es in:


<a href="../tags.php&#63;/<&#63;php echo urlencode($fields['tag']); &#63;>/" target="_blank">{dede:field.tag /}</a> 
[选择]
Hilfe zur Verwendung:

Um die Seite zu ändern, können Sie auf der Seite „Hinzufügen“ nachschlagen, um JS-Code hinzuzufügen.

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n